如何正确实现PHP网站优化

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站优化
logo
汤雨阳

网站优化  2024-12-28 11:25:51   381

如何正确实现PHP网站优化

PHP网站优化的重要性

PHP作为一种流行的服务器端脚本语言,广泛应用于网站开发。随着网站流量和数据的增长,如果不进行适当的优化,网站性能将受到影响,用户体验也会下降。PHP网站优化对于提升网站运行效率、保障数据安全、提高用户体验具有重要意义。

PHP网站优化的实施步骤

1. 代码优化

a. 精简代码:去除无用代码,减少代码冗余,提高代码执行效率。
  b. 使用合适的数据结构和算法:针对网站功能需求,选择合适的数据结构和算法,以提高数据处理速度。
  c. 减少HTTP请求:通过合并CSS、JS文件,使用缓存等技术,减少HTTP请求次数,提高网页加载速度。
  2. 数据库优化

a. 选择合适的数据库:根据网站需求,选择合适的数据库类型和存储方案。
  b. 数据库索引优化:为常用查询字段建立索引,提高查询速度。
  c. 定期维护数据库:清理无用数据,优化表结构,提高数据库性能。
  3. 服务器优化

a. 选择高性能服务器:根据网站访问量和数据量,选择合适的服务器配置。
  b. 使用负载均衡:通过分发请求到多个服务器,提高网站的并发处理能力。
  c. 定期监控服务器性能:对服务器进行定期监控和维护,及时发现并解决问题。
  4. 缓存优化

a. 使用缓存技术:如Memcached、Redis等,缓存常用数据和页面,减少数据库和服务器压力。
  b. 设置合理的缓存策略:根据数据更新频率和访问量,设置合适的缓存时间和清理策略。
  c. 利用页面静态化技术:将动态页面转化为静态页面,提高页面加载速度。
  5. 安全优化

a. 输入验证与过滤:对用户输入进行严格的验证和过滤,防止SQL注入、XSS攻击等安全漏洞。
  b. 使用HTTPS协议:通过HTTPS协议加密网站数据传输,保障用户数据安全。
  c. 定期更新软件与插件:及时更新PHP版本、数据库软件、插件等,修复已知的安全漏洞。
  d. 备份与恢复策略:定期备份网站数据和数据库,制定完善的恢复策略,以应对可能的数据丢失或损坏情况。
  6. 用户体验优化

a. 响应式设计:针对不同设备和屏幕尺寸进行优化设计,提高网站在不同设备上的显示效果和用户体验。
  b. 页面加载速度优化:通过上述提到的各种技术手段,提高页面加载速度,减少用户等待时间。
  c. 提供友好的用户界面和操作流程:设计简洁明了的用户界面和操作流程,提高用户使用网站的便捷性和舒适度。
  d. 提供有用的内容和功能:根据用户需求和反馈,不断优化和丰富网站内容和功能,提高用户满意度和粘性。